The Basics of Bond Laddering

Bond laddering is a popular investment strategy used by many investors to diversify their fixed income investments for a more stable and predictable portfolio. By building a bond ladder, investors can spread out the maturity dates of their bonds, reducing the impact of interest rate fluctuations on their overall portfolio. This strategy allows investors to have a mix of short-term and long-term bonds, providing a steady stream of income while also taking advantage of potentially higher yields on longer-term bonds.

What is Bond Laddering?

Bond laddering is a strategy where an investor buys bonds with staggered maturity dates. Instead of investing all of your money into a single bond with a fixed maturity date, you can build a ladder by purchasing bonds with different maturity dates across various time horizons. This way, you can ensure a steady cash flow as each bond matures, while also having the flexibility to reinvest the proceeds at prevailing interest rates.

How to Use Tax Loss Harvesting to Offset Gains

Tax loss harvesting is a strategy that investors can use to lower their tax liability by selling investments that have decreased in value and realizing capital losses. By strategically selling losing investments, investors can offset gains in their portfolio and reduce the amount of taxes they owe. This technique is especially useful for high-net-worth individuals who have significant capital gains and want to lower their overall tax burden.

Understanding Tax Loss Harvesting

Before delving into the benefits and strategies of tax loss harvesting, it is important to understand the concept itself. When an investor sells an investment for a lower price than they paid for it, they incur a capital loss. These capital losses can be used to offset capital gains realized in the same year, thereby reducing the amount of taxable gains.
